Technical Specifications and Best Practices
Large structures, such as buildings, are available in both blueprint and static mesh formats. However, Nanite performs better when using the blueprint versions. Additionally, opting for the static mesh format may impact the loading time of your map. This is due to the increased poly count of the individual meshes. Therefore, using the provided blueprints is the recommended workflow for most users.
Virtual Textures and Setup
To ensure the materials work properly, the demo map requires Virtual Textures. Users must go to the Project Settings and enable Virtual Textures Support. If this setting is not enabled, the materials will not render as intended. Specifically, this step is crucial for maintaining the visual quality described by the creator.
